Independiente Del Valle deny Manchester Utd interest in Moises Caicedo

Independiente Del Valle general manager Santiago Morales dismisses suggestions that Manchester United are attempting to sign youngster Moises Caicedo.

Independiente del Valle general manager Santiago Morales has played down speculation linking Moises Caicedo with a move to Manchester United.

The Premier League giants have been heavily linked with the midfielder, who could be available for a fee in the region of €6m (£5.42m).

However, despite acknowledging that the 19-year-old is likely to leave the club during 2021, Morales has insisted that United have not made any contact regarding a deal.

Speaking to Radio La Red, Morales said: "There's interest from various teams for Moises Caicedo and we believe that we will not have him this year.

"There is much speculation with Moises Caicedo, but we haven't had any communication with Manchester United.

"We are surprised that they even talk about values, but we haven't spoken with Manchester United, although we have spoken with other great teams in the world."

Caicedo, who has three-and-a-half years left on his contract, has already earned four caps with Ecuador.
